OTR driver pay in 2026
OTR (over-the-road) is the highest-volume CDL category — and the most competitive for carriers to recruit. Pay has increased meaningfully since 2022 as the driver shortage persists. Here is what the market actually looks like for solo and team OTR in 2026.
Solo OTR pay by experience
| Experience Level | Typical CPM | Avg Weekly Miles | Est. Annual |
|---|---|---|---|
| 0–1 year (recent grad) | $0.50 – $0.56 | 2,200 – 2,600 | $57K – $72K |
| 1–3 years | $0.56 – $0.64 | 2,600 – 3,000 | $71K – $86K |
| 3–5 years | $0.62 – $0.70 | 2,800 – 3,200 | $80K – $95K |
| 5+ years | $0.66 – $0.78 | 2,800 – 3,400 | $85K – $110K |
Team OTR pay
Team OTR averages 5,000–6,000 miles per week split between two drivers. At $0.72–$0.85 CPM split, each driver earns the equivalent of a high solo OTR rate with significantly more miles. Team is the fastest path to $90K+ in CDL earnings.
| Configuration | CPM (split) | Miles/Week (each) | Est. Annual (each)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Team OTR — experienced | $0.72 – $0.85 split | 2,500 – 3,000 | $85K – $115K |
| Team OTR — entry level | $0.60 – $0.72 split | 2,500 – 3,000 | $72K – $95K |
What affects OTR pay most
- Miles consistency — the difference between a carrier that delivers 2,800 miles/week consistently vs one that averages 2,200 is $8,000–$12,000 per year at the same CPM.
- Freight type — flatbed, reefer, and tanker add $0.04–$0.15 CPM above dry van OTR rates.
- Sign-on bonus structure — OTR sign-on bonuses typically run $3,000–$10,000 in 2026, paid in installments over 6–12 months.
- Benefits package — health insurance, 401K, and paid time off add $8,000–$15,000 in value annually on top of base CPM.
For employers posting OTR jobs
OTR drivers check your CPM rate and weekly mile average first. If your rate is below $0.58 CPM or you cannot guarantee consistent miles, experienced drivers will pass.
